P0498
EVAP System Vent Valve Control Circuit Low
P0498 is an OBD-II diagnostic trouble code meaning: EVAP System Vent Valve Control Circuit Low. Common causes: faulty evap vent valve, open or short circuit in wiring harness. Estimated repair cost: $56–167.
Symptoms
- Check Engine light comes on
- Increased fuel consumption
- Unstable engine idling
Causes
- Faulty EVAP vent valve
- Open or short circuit in wiring harness
- Problems with power or circuit ground
- ECU malfunction
How to Fix
- Check the integrity of the wiring harness
- Check EVAP valve resistance
- Check power and ground circuit
- Replace faulty EVAP valve if necessary
